U-U Church Hosts Jewish-Palestinian Dialogue
Mark Gabrish Conlan/Zenger's Newsmagazine,

Miko Peled The members of the Jewish-Palestinian Dialogue movement that presented a program at the First Unitarian-Universalist Church in Hillcrest April 14 are trying to work beyond the long-standing conflict between Israel and Palestine and not only get to know each other as people but tell each other’s stories and try to bridge the communications gap between them as a way of building mutual understanding and hopefully, eventually, peace.

Students Stage Sleep Strike for DREAM Act
Mark Gabrish Conlan/Zenger's Newsmagazine,

Angel Hernandez and Robi Aguilar “We’re not going to sleep until these students are allowed to dream.” That’s how local student activists Angel Hernandez and Rubi Aguilar explained the four-day “sleep strike” they mounted outside the Federal Building at Front and Broadway in downtown San Diego April 8-11 in support of the DREAM (Development, Relief and Education for Alien Minors) Act to allow the foreign-born children of undocumented immigrants to obtain legal status to attend college or join the military. A rally and press conference Saturday, April 17, noon, outside the San Diego City College library at 12th and “B” Street downtown, will organize further public support for the DREAM Act.

Audre Lorde Tribute in Sherman Heights
Mark Gabrish Conlan,

A tribute to the late African-American Lesbian feminist author and activist Audre Lorde took place at the Sherman Heights Community Center April 12. Held in conjunction with the American Education Research Association convention in town, the event featured a 12-minute excerpt from the new video, "The Edge of Each Other's Battles: The Vision of Audre Lorde," and a panel of local education activists. The complete video will be shown Sunday, April 18, 6 p.m., at the World Beat Center, 2100 Park Boulevard in Balboa Park.

Same-Sex Marriage Forum at Malcolm X Library
Mark Gabrish Conlan/Zenger's Newsmagazine,

A coalition of Queer community groups in association with the local chapters of the NAACP and ACLU held a community forum March 29 at the Malcolm X Library to discuss whether the U.S. Constitution should be amended to ban same-sex marriage. Four of the five panelists opposed the proposed Amendment as a constitutional sanction of discrimination that could be used later as a precedent against people of color and other oppressed groups.

Same-Sex Marriage Rally Article, 3/18/04
Mark Gabrish Conlan,

Over 100 people attended a rally outside the San Diego County Administration Center downtown on March 18 to call for California to recognize marriages between same-sex partners as legal, despite only two days’ notice and a near-exclusive reliance on e-mail to publicize the event. Their primary demand was for action at the state level: specifically passage of a bill called the Marriage License Nondiscrimination Act, which would make marriage “gender-neutral” and available equally to same-sex and opposite-sex couples.

Jeffrey Mittman: Equality & Same-Sex Marriage
Mark Gabrish Conlan/Zenger's Newsmagazine,

Jeffrey Mittman The statewide Queer lobbying organization Equality California [EQCA] — which until recently was called California Association for Pride and Equality [CAPE] and before that was the Lobby for Individual Freedom and Equality [LIFE] — has sent Bay Area attorney Jeffrey Mittman to San Diego as the first official in any California statewide Queer organization to be based here. What’s more, EQCA has chosen San Diego to be the pilot city in an ambitious electoral outreach program called the California Voter Project. Zenger’s interviewed Mittman on March 17 and mostly discussed the same-sex marriage issue.

Local Chicana Activist Detained by feds
sd,

Alvina Martínez de Moreno, a Human Rights observer since 2002 and a leading member of the Barrio Logan Human Rights Committee of the Raza Rights Coalition in San Diego, California was apprehended inside her home by federal agents on the evening of Thursday, March 18, 2004.
